What they do

A Park Ranger leads informational programs for park visitors about the history and environmental features of public parks, and promote awareness of protecting park land. Welcomes and provides assistance to park visitors, assists with educational programs, oversees park events and activities and patrols park land.

Golf Course Ranger City of Ann Arbor - 3.6 Ann Arbor, MI Job Details Part-time From $16.93 an hour 8 hours ago Qualifications Sports rule interpretation
Driver's License Full Job Description Golf Course Ranger Starting Hourly Rate:
$16.93 Oversees golf course play. Enforces golf course rules and regulations through constant surveillance and monitoring of golf play throughout the course.
Required Qualifications :
Minimum of 18 years of age Thorough knowledge of golf rules and etiquette Must have a valid Driver's License Must obtain CPR/AED and First Aid certification within 30 days of employment. The City offers CPR/AED and First Aid classes, which are free to Parks employees. Please note, your certification must be from an organization that has been approved by the Bureau of Community and Health Systems, Child Care Licensing Division. Please see link (https://www.michigan.gov/lara/0,4601,7-154-89334_63294_5529_49572_49583-82382 -,00.html) for list of approved organizations.
Preferred Qualifications :
Past experience in dealing with the general public in a public relations role
Physical Requirements :
May exert up to 20 lbs of force occasionally, and/or up to 10 lbs of force frequently, and/or negligible amount of force constantly to move objects.
